    who are the cabinet makers? do you mind me asking how much extra they charged for aligning the laminate woodgrain?

    It's nice work, isn't it ?. I'm pretty sure Prime Cabinets are the cabinetmakers. He's a bit old school but beautiful. Horizontal grain wasn't much extra, I think $200 but there is horizontal grain and then there is the attention to detail match like this.
